The study of non-living matter and processes; the science of abiotic things and abiogenesis.
From a- (not) + biology (study of life). This theoretical field encompasses chemistry, geology, and physics as they relate to the origin of life and non-living systems.
Abiology isn't a common term today, but it represents an important concept—that understanding life requires understanding the abiotic chemistry and physics that came before and enabled it.
